Magnesium: The Master Mineral for Energy and Recovery

Often dubbed the “master mineral,” magnesium is involved in over 300 biochemical reactions in the body, many of which are directly related to energy production and muscle function. Despite its critical role, magnesium deficiency is surprisingly common, especially among active individuals and those with diets high in processed foods.

How it Supports Stamina and Energy:

  • ATP Production: Magnesium is essential for the synthesis of adenosine triphosphate (ATP), the primary energy currency of your cells. Without adequate magnesium, your body struggles to convert food into usable energy, leading to fatigue and low stamina.
  • Muscle Function and Recovery: It plays a vital role in muscle contraction and relaxation. Deficiency can manifest as muscle cramps, spasms, and prolonged soreness, hindering your ability to perform and recover from physical activity. By supporting proper muscle function, magnesium helps you push harder and recover faster.
  • Nervous System Regulation: Magnesium contributes to nerve signal transmission and neurotransmitter function, helping to regulate your nervous system. This can reduce feelings of anxiety and promote a sense of calm, indirectly boosting mental energy and focus.
  • Improved Sleep Quality: Magnesium helps activate the parasympathetic nervous system, which is responsible for relaxation. It binds to GABA receptors, calming nerve activity and promoting restful sleep. Better sleep directly translates to improved daytime energy and stamina.

Practical Advice:

  • Dosing: A common effective dose ranges from 200-400mg per day. It’s often best taken in the evening to support sleep.
  • Quality Markers: Look for highly absorbable forms like magnesium glycinate (excellent for sleep and relaxation, gentle on the stomach), magnesium citrate (good for general deficiency, can have a laxative effect in higher doses), or magnesium malate (often recommended for energy and muscle pain). Avoid magnesium oxide, which has poor bioavailability.
  • Third-Party Testing: Always opt for brands that conduct third-party testing to ensure purity, potency, and absence of contaminants.

Zinc: The Unsung Hero for Testosterone and Immunity

Zinc is an essential trace mineral that plays a crucial role in numerous bodily functions, including immune health, wound healing, and DNA synthesis. For men, its significance extends to hormonal balance, particularly in maintaining healthy testosterone levels – a key determinant of energy, libido, and muscle mass.

How it Supports Stamina and Energy:

  • Testosterone Production: Zinc is intimately involved in the enzymatic processes that lead to testosterone synthesis. Low zinc levels have been directly linked to reduced testosterone, which can manifest as decreased energy, stamina, muscle weakness, and reduced libido. Ensuring adequate zinc intake helps maintain optimal hormonal balance.
  • Immune System Function: A robust immune system is fundamental to sustained energy. When your body is constantly fighting off infections, it diverts significant energy resources, leaving you feeling drained. Zinc is critical for the development and function of immune cells, helping you stay healthy and energetic.
  • Protein Synthesis and Repair: Zinc is essential for protein synthesis and cell growth, which are vital for muscle repair and recovery after exercise. Efficient recovery means you’re ready to tackle your next challenge with renewed vigor.
  • Antioxidant Properties: It acts as an antioxidant, helping to protect cells from oxidative stress, which can contribute to fatigue and cellular damage.

Practical Advice:

  • Dosing: For most men, a daily dose of 15-30mg is sufficient. It’s often recommended to take zinc with food to prevent stomach upset.
  • Quality Markers: Choose chelated forms like zinc picolinate, zinc gluconate, or zinc citrate, as these are generally better absorbed than zinc oxide.
  • Balance with Copper: High doses of zinc over extended periods can interfere with copper absorption. If you’re taking more than 30mg of zinc daily, consider a supplement that also includes a small amount of copper (e.g., 1-2mg) or consult with a healthcare professional.

B-Complex Vitamins: The Energy Conversion Specialists

The B-complex vitamins are a group of eight water-soluble vitamins (B1, B2, B3, B5, B6, B7, B9, and B12) that are indispensable for cellular metabolism. Their primary role is to help your body convert the food you eat – carbohydrates, fats, and proteins – into usable energy (ATP). Without sufficient B vitamins, your body’s energy factories simply can’t run efficiently.

How it Supports Stamina and Energy:

  • Metabolic Powerhouses: Each B vitamin plays a unique yet interconnected role in energy metabolism. For example, Thiamine (B1), Riboflavin (B2), and Niacin (B3) are crucial for breaking down glucose and fatty acids. Pantothenic Acid (B5) is vital for the synthesis of coenzyme A, a key molecule in energy production.
  • Reduces Tiredness and Fatigue: By optimizing energy conversion, B vitamins directly combat feelings of tiredness and fatigue. They ensure that the fuel you consume is effectively utilized to power your body and mind.
  • Nervous System Health: Several B vitamins, particularly B6, B9 (folate), and B12, are essential for neurotransmitter synthesis and nerve function. This supports cognitive function, mood regulation, and overall mental energy.
  • Red Blood Cell Formation: Vitamin B12 and Folate (B9) are critical for the production of healthy red blood cells, which transport oxygen throughout the body. Adequate oxygen delivery is fundamental for sustained energy and physical stamina.

Practical Advice:

  • Dosing: A good quality B-complex supplement will provide a balanced spectrum of all eight B vitamins, typically in doses that meet or exceed the daily recommended intake.
  • Quality Markers: Look for supplements that contain the activated or methylated forms of B vitamins, such as methylcobalamin (B12) and methylfolate (B9). These forms are more readily utilized by the body, especially for individuals with genetic variations that affect B vitamin metabolism.
  • Timing: B-complex vitamins are best taken in the morning or early afternoon, as their energizing effects might interfere with sleep if taken too late in the day.

Creatine: The Gold Standard for Power and Performance

Creatine is one of the most extensively researched and scientifically validated supplements available, with a robust body of evidence supporting its benefits for strength, power, and muscle growth. It’s not just for elite athletes; men aged 25-35 looking to improve their gym performance, recovery, and even cognitive function can benefit significantly.

How it Supports Stamina and Energy:

  • ATP Regeneration: Creatine’s primary mechanism of action is its role in regenerating ATP, particularly during short bursts of high-intensity activity. It acts as a rapid energy reserve, allowing your muscles to perform more repetitions, lift heavier weights, and sustain intense effort for longer before fatigue sets in. This directly translates to improved anaerobic stamina.
  • Increased Strength and Power Output: By enhancing ATP availability, creatine allows for greater force production, leading to significant improvements in strength and power. This means better performance in weightlifting, sprinting, and other explosive movements.
  • Enhanced Muscle Growth: Creatine draws water into muscle cells, increasing cell volume and potentially stimulating protein synthesis. It also allows for more effective training, which is a key driver of muscle hypertrophy.
  • Improved Recovery: By aiding in ATP regeneration and reducing muscle cell damage, creatine can accelerate recovery between sets and after workouts, allowing you to train more frequently and effectively.
  • Cognitive Benefits: Emerging research suggests creatine may also support brain health, improving memory and cognitive function, especially in situations of sleep deprivation or mental stress.

Practical Advice:

  • Dosing: The most common and effective protocol involves a “loading phase” of 20g per day (divided into 4 doses) for 5-7 days, followed by a “maintenance phase” of 3-5g per day. The loading phase is optional but can saturate muscle creatine stores faster. Consistent daily intake is key.
  • Form: Creatine monohydrate is the most studied, effective, and cost-efficient form. Don’t be swayed by marketing claims for more expensive, less-proven forms.
  • Quality Markers: Look for micronized creatine monohydrate for better solubility and absorption. Brands with Creapure® certification guarantee high purity and quality.
  • Hydration: Ensure adequate water intake when supplementing with creatine, as it draws water into muscle cells.

Omega-3 Fatty Acids: The Anti-Inflammatory Edge for Recovery

Omega-3 fatty acids, particularly e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A), are essential fats renowned for their wide-ranging health benefits, from cardiovascular health to brain function. For active men, their powerful anti-inflammatory properties are particularly relevant for sustaining energy and optimizing recovery.

How it Supports Stamina and Energy:

  • Reduces Exercise-Induced Inflammation: Intense physical activity inevitably causes microscopic damage to muscle fibers, leading to inflammation and delayed onset muscle soreness (DOMS). Omega-3s, especially EPA, help to modulate the body’s inflammatory response, reducing muscle soreness and accelerating recovery. Less inflammation means you feel less stiff and fatigued, allowing you to get back to training sooner and with more energy.
  • Improved Cardiovascular Health: Omega-3s support heart health by improving blood vessel function, reducing triglyceride levels, and maintaining healthy blood pressure. A healthy cardiovascular system is crucial for efficient oxygen and nutrient delivery to working muscles, directly impacting stamina.
  • Enhanced Brain Function: DHA is a major structural component of the brain. Adequate omega-3 intake supports cognitive function, focus, and mood, which are all vital for sustained mental energy throughout your day.
  • Joint Health: By reducing inflammation, omega-3s can also support joint health, which is critical for maintaining consistent physical activity without pain or discomfort.

Practical Advice:

  • Dosing: Aim for a combined EPA+DHA intake of 1-3 grams per day. The specific ratio of EPA to DHA can vary, but a higher EPA content is often favored for inflammation reduction.
  • Quality Markers: Choose a high-quality fish oil supplement that is molecularly distilled to remove heavy metals (like mercury) and other contaminants (PCBs). Look for products in the triglyceride form, as this is more bioavailable than ethyl ester forms. Third-party testing (e.g., IFOS certification) is a strong indicator of purity and potency.
  • Dietary Sources: While supplements are effective, also prioritize dietary sources like fatty fish (salmon, mackerel, sardines) 2-3 times per week.

Ashwagandha: The Adaptogen for Stress Resilience and Stamina (Optional)

Ashwagandha (Withania somnifera) is an ancient adaptogenic herb widely used in Ayurvedic medicine. Adaptogens are unique in their ability to help the body adapt to various stressors, promoting balance and resilience. While not a direct energy booster in the way B vitamins are, Ashwagandha can significantly impact stamina and energy by improving your body’s stress response.

How it Supports Stamina and Energy:

  • Stress Reduction and Cortisol Modulation: Chronic stress leads to elevated cortisol levels, which can deplete energy, impair sleep, and negatively impact overall well-being. Ashwagandha helps to regulate the hypothalamic-pituitary-adrenal (HPA) axis, reducing cortisol and promoting a sense of calm. By mitigating the physiological toll of stress, it frees up energy for other functions.
  • Improved Stamina and Endurance: Several studies suggest Ashwagandha can enhance cardiorespiratory endurance (VO2 max) and overall stamina, likely by improving energy utilization and reducing perceived exertion during exercise.
  • Enhanced Strength and Muscle Recovery: Some research indicates Ashwagandha may contribute to increased muscle strength and faster recovery, potentially by reducing exercise-induced muscle damage and inflammation.
  • Better Sleep Quality: By promoting relaxation and reducing stress, Ashwagandha can indirectly improve sleep quality, leading to more restorative rest and increased daytime energy.

Practical Advice:

  • Dosing: Typical effective doses range from 300-600mg of a standardized root extract per day. It’s often taken in two divided doses or once in the evening.
  • Quality Markers: Look for standardized extracts, such as KSM-66 or Sensoril, which guarantee a specific concentration of active compounds called withanolides. These patented extracts are backed by clinical research.
  • Consideration: Ashwagandha is generally well-tolerated, but as with any herbal supplement, it’s wise to start with a lower dose and monitor your response. It’s an “optional” supplement because its benefits are more indirect and may not be necessary for everyone, but it can be a powerful tool for those experiencing chronic stress or seeking an extra edge in resilience.

Conclusion: Supplements as an Enhancement, Not a Replacement

Supplements are powerful tools, but they are not magic pills. They work best when integrated into a lifestyle that prioritizes foundational health practices. Think of them as the final polish on a well-built machine, not the engine itself.

Before reaching for any supplement, ensure you’re consistently nailing the basics:

  • Nutrition: A whole-foods diet rich in fruits, vegetables, lean proteins, and healthy fats.
  • Sleep: 7-9 hours of quality sleep per night.
  • Exercise: Regular physical activity, combining strength training and cardiovascular exercise.
  • Stress Management: Techniques like mindfulness, meditation, or spending time in nature.

By addressing these pillars first, you create an optimal environment for supplements to exert their full benefits. Start with the foundational supplements like Magnesium, Zinc, and a B-Complex, then consider Creatine for performance and Omega-3 for recovery. Ashwagandha can be a valuable addition if stress is a significant factor in your energy levels.

Track your progress, pay attention to how your body feels, and be patient – consistent effort yields the best results. Investing in your energy and stamina now is an investment in your future, allowing you to excel in every aspect of your life.
